Q: Is 712,445,034 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 712,445,034 is not a prime number.

Why is 712,445,034 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 712445034 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 7 14 21 42 16,962,977 33,925,954 50,888,931 101,777,862 118,740,839 237,481,678 356,222,517 and 712,445,034, with no remainder.

Since 712,445,034 cannot be divided by just 1 and 712,445,034, it is not a prime number.
